Man Kills Four in Hungary Sword Attack


Budapest, Apr 7 (IANS): A 24-year-old man in Hungary killed four people with a sword and injured three others after a family argument, CNN reported.

The killer in Kulcs town, south of the capital Budapest, used "weapons that were able to stab and cut, and the crime was brutal", Laszlo Garamvolgyi of the Hungarian police was quoted as saying by state-owned news agency MTI.

The police official said a family argument led to the attack.

Police said 135 officers were involved in an operation to capture the man, alongside members of the counter-terror unit.

Janos Hajdu, director of the terror unit, said the suspect was carrying "sharp weapons" but did not resist arrest, according to state-run Hungarian TV.

The man was found by a police dog while he was hiding behind a bush near the home where the attack happened. The suspect, thought to have suffered injuries in the attack, was taken to a hospital.

The mayor of Kulcs said locals described the family as normal and hard-working.
